Introduction
Key Changes to the Standard
| Key Changes | 2008 Edition | 2019 Edition |
|---|---|---|
| Definition of Terms | Seroconversion, Window Period of 3 Weeks | HIV Serum Antibody Conversion, Window Period of 1-3 Weeks (Divided into Antibody/Antigen/Nucleic Acid) |
| Detection Methods | Antibody Confirmatory Test | HIV Supplementary Test (Including Nucleic Acid Test) |
| Diagnostic Criteria | Antibody Test Only | Antibody + Nucleic Acid Combined Diagnosis (>5000 CPs/mL) |
Laboratory Testing Technical Specifications
Three-tier Detection System
- Screening test: ELISA/chemiluminescence method, results expressed as reactive/non-reactive
- Supplementary tests:
- Western blot test (WB)
- Nucleic acid test (qualitative/quantitative)
- Confirmation basis: Nucleic acid>5000 CPs/mL or two positive results
Key points for the implementation of clinical staging
Adult staging standards
| Stages | CD4 Count | Key Indicators |
|---|---|---|
| Stage I (Early Stage) | >500 | Acute Infectious Syndrome/PGL |
| Stage II (Intermediate Stage) | 200-500 | Recurrent Bacterial Infections/Oral Leukoplakia |
| Stage III (AIDS) | <200 | Opportunistic Infections/Malignant Tumors |
Special Considerations for Children
- Under 18 Months: Two Positive Nucleic Acid Tests Required (≥4 Weeks Apart)
- Immune assessment: CD4 percentage is used (<25% at 12 months of age is considered severe deficiency)
Recommendations for implementation of the standard
- Window period management: Nucleic acid testing can be performed 1 week after exposure, and antibody testing 3 weeks later
- Child diagnosis: Children whose mothers are HIV-positive should complete the first nucleic acid screening within 48 hours of birth
- Result interpretation: Reactive samples must be confirmed by additional tests to avoid false positives
